## Deployment — Crashline Pipeline

Crashline ingests crash reports from the Ovetta mobile apps and routes them to triage queues. Support team: deployments happen weekdays at 10:00 local, and ingestion pauses for under a minute during rollout, so brief gaps in the dashboard are expected. If reports stall longer, check the worker pool first. The deployed configuration values for the current release are listed here.

service settings:
[casax]
port = 6379
team = rusir
host = casax.zemvarhq.corp
region = outer-4
access_code = ac_9808ce
timeout_ms = 1500

Orvane Technologies alleges that our Bramfeld toolkit exceeds the scope of the 2021 license governing the embedded rendering module. Their counsel proposes mediation; ours considers the claim weak but notes genuine ambiguity in the field-of-use clause. Exposure is bounded by the contract's cap, though reputational considerations in the Dunmore market warrant care. Settlement discussions begin next month under strict confidentiality. Our position and the related confidential business plan are summarized immediately below.

confidential, kajof-tahof: The pricing group signed off on a budget of $491.8 million for Project Casvan.

OFF-SITE RUN — CHECKLIST ITEM 4 (Dispatch Desk)

Item: notarised deed for the Brackenford parcel, prepared by Oswin & Tarle.
Envelope: sealed, red tamper strip, do not reopen. Keep flat; no folding, no clips. Deed travels alone — nothing else in the pouch. Sign the custody sheet at pickup and again at drop. Recipient is the registrar's clerk at the Cawdale annex, morning window only. If the clerk is absent, return the deed unopened. The courier hand-over instruction appears immediately below.

handover note for yagef-bagep: the drudor pelius courier leaves the kasdor zorvan norir ledger at gate 8016 under passcode 755406